The paraboloid distribution on a curve for automotive lighting describes a specialized light distribution technique where parabolic reflectors are arranged along a defined curve geometry. This principle is commonly used in modern headlights and taillights to optimize light direction and ensure uniform illumination of the road or vehicle rear.Technical Features:• Paraboloid Reflectors: Utilize the physical properties of paraboloids to efficiently direct and focus light beams.• Curve-Based Arrangement: Enables precise light distribution along the vehicle’s profile, ideal for aerodynamic and design optimizations.• Applications: Headlights with specific beam patterns (e.g., low beam, high beam) and taillights featuring dynamic signal effects or homogeneous light distribution.A 3D model for CGTrader could be designed as a parametric geometry with customizable curves and reflector shapes, making it suitable for engineers and designers integrating it into vehicle lighting concepts.
